"While the Jurassic Bee evolved, lived and became myth, the Primordial Bee has lived in peaceful isolation, tending to the forgotten roots of the world."

The Primordial Bee is a Tier 4 Social Bee species is a special species found in the underwater Geode Caves.

There are three different underwater areas that have an entrance to a Geode Cave when the sludge is cleared, only one of them has the Primordial Bee inside.

Traits

These are the different Traits that the Primordial Bee can spawn with.

When a trait has multiple values one is picked randomly when the bee is created.

Lifespan Long, Ancient

Productivity Slowest, Slow

Fertility Unlucky, Fertile

Stability Unstable, Normal

Behaviour Cathemeral

Climate Temperate


Hints

The Apiarist's Almanac gives the following hint:
This species can only be found in forgotten places, hidden beneath the seabed..

When asking Dr Beenjamin BhD for a hint he says the following:
Primordial huh? Your Grandfather predictied a common ancestor, a precursor of even the Jurassic Bees you found, but I don't know of any places that old. Perhaps the Director might have some ideas?
